Understanding the Dimensions of the 6228 Bearing A Comprehensive Guide In the world of mechanical engineering, bearings play an essential role in facilitating smooth and efficient motion. One such bearing that garners significant attention is the 6228 bearing. This deep groove ball bearing, with its specific dimensions, offers exceptional performance in various applications where load-bearing and rotational precision are crucial. The 6228 bearing, as per its designation, adheres to the International Organization for Standardization (ISO) system, which standardizes bearing dimensions globally. The first two digits, '62', indicate that it belongs to the single-row deep groove ball bearing series. The next two digits, '28', denote the bore diameter, which in this case is 140 millimeters. This dimension is critical as it determines the inner space through which the shaft will rotate. The outer diameter of the 6228 bearing stands at 250mm, providing a broad surface area for support and distributing loads effectively. The width, or the distance between the two raceways, is 40mm, contributing to the bearing's stability and load-bearing capacity. These dimensions make the 6228 bearing suitable for applications requiring medium to high radial and axial loads, such as motors, pumps, and agricultural machinery. The deep grooves ensure a large storage space for lubricants, enhancing the bearing's lifespan and operational efficiency. When considering the dimensions of the 6228 bearing, it is crucial to factor in tolerances, clearances, and the material used. Tolerances define the allowable deviation from the nominal dimensions, while clearances refer to the space between the inner and outer rings when no load is applied. High-quality materials like chrome steel, known for its hardness and wear resistance, are typically employed in manufacturing these bearings.
